		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hi everyone &#8211; just thought I&#8217;d share my experience of Lupron as it&#8217;s been mostly positive and I read so so many negative stories before i had the injections (I scared myself crapless before deciding to go with the injections anway).</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ve had three of the one-month shots, except my drug is called Lucrin. Same drug, different name where I live. I had barely any shrinkage in the first two months and was pretty gutted, but three weeks later i had another scan and the fibroid had shrunk from around 10cm at the largest dimension, to around 8.cm. Taking into account that the other two measurements had some shrinkage too, that works out at about 40% less volume, which is awesome as far as I&#8217;m concerned.</p>
<p>I haven&#8217;t had any of the moodiness or loss of sex drive I was worried about. The main symptom has been some crazy hot flashes throughout the day and night, which are annoying but easy to cope with as they only last a few minutes. I also have some muscle aches, particularly in my legs when I stand up after sitting down for a while, but that may not be related to the shots.</p>
<p>Other than that it&#8217;s all been good and i may be able to have a laparoscopic myomectomy next week, rather than the big open abdominal myomectomy. I won&#8217;t actually find out which I&#8217;ve had until I wake up, so please keep your fingers crossed for me ladies.</p>
<p>I hope all goes well with you if you&#8217;re taking Lupron, please keep posting your experiences.</p>
